Output bd4eb600aa60cbf76cd94822fc4d060bc7612abed3ea0e8d8a65e7fef8d0c36b:0

value
637933705
script pubkey
OP_0 OP_PUSHBYTES_32 3c21ee744fed30f8aa6c86a2dbea83c0d63d85b1fb4e4afc1fd7279b237125d0
address
bc1q8ss7uaz0a5c032nvs63dh65rcrtrmpd3ld8y4lql6unekgm3yhgqsuwm5h
transaction
bd4eb600aa60cbf76cd94822fc4d060bc7612abed3ea0e8d8a65e7fef8d0c36b
confirmations
165530
spent
true